BUCHANAN - Donald L. Huron , 75, of 817 Rynearson, Apt. 2, died at 10 p.m. Friday in his home of natural causes. Mr. Huron had been a real estate appraiser. He was born Feb. 1, 1920, in Kokomo. On April 5, 1941, in Detroit, he married Merita C. Schneider. She died Aug. 29, 1993. Surviving are a daughter; two grandchildren; and two brothers, Bart of Niles and William of Cleveland. A son, Glen, born in 1948 died Dec. 1, 1964. He was a member of Moose Lodge 449 and First Presbyterian Church and was a World War II veteran of the Army Air Corps.
Memorial services will be at 11 a.m. Wednesday in Swem Funeral Home. Friends may call from 3 to 5 and 6 to 8 p.m. Tuesday in the funeral home. Memorial contributions may be made to the church.
He was the son of Lloyd Benjamin Huron and Hazel Kirk Legg.
He served in the US Air Force WWII and was a POW in Europe.
